Melon

Melon

HQ
Orlando, Florida
110 Total Employees
Year Founded: 2017

Jobs at Similar Companies

Austin, TX
Hybrid
Marina Del Rey & Playa Vista
Hybrid

Similar Companies Hiring

Software • Retail • Marketing Tech • Hardware • Digital Media • AdTech
2 Offices
43 Employees
Software • Information Technology • Consulting • Cloud • Big Data Analytics • Artificial Intelligence • App development
Denver, CO
12 Employees
Marketing Tech • Machine Learning • Digital Media • Big Data Analytics • Analytics • Agency • AdTech
2 Offices
50 Employees